**Step-by-Step Solution:** 1. **Introduction to Bacteria:** - Bacteria are microscopic, unicellular organisms that play various roles in our environment. While some bacteria are known to cause diseases, many have beneficial effects that are crucial for life. 2. **Role in Waste Management:** - Bacteria contribute significantly to waste management through the process of decomposition. They break down organic matter, recycling nutrients back into the ecosystem and acting as natural scavengers. ...
